Well a while ago I did something like this. I placed a web cam in my office and wrote a program that sent a picture every 30 sec to my web site. I created a web page that I could watch at work. It could have sent a pic every sec but my bandwidth would have reached limits. I even went as far as putting the camera on a servo and integrated a microprocessor that communicated to the PC via USB. This allowed me to pan from left to right.

So yea it doable! I used Visual basic and If you need some code I can send it here. Also I think I used coffee cup for the web page, but any thing would work.

I have looked into several different spycam software. I think any decent hacker should have his house or computer room protected by a tattletail like a spycam. The evidence is even used by the police to catch baby-beating nannies and home invaders.
Your file size or compression scheme will depend on the software you choose. The best thing to do is just get motion sensing feature in your spycam ware, that way you only store files of activity, not long dead video of nothing happening. You also want to choose your spycam software that best serves you - sending email snapshots of activity, or just storing the file locally, encrypted and covert. Not all spycam ware offer all these features, some are too obvious, some are easily shutdown or manipulated - like snapshots being deleted by the intruder.

use the keywords "spycam software" in google and you'll have a wide range to pick from.
